Macroeconomics
In January-July, the State Tax Service transferred 51.40 billion lei to the national public budget, 5.00 billion lei (+10.90%) more year on year. The state budget received more than 21.10 billion lei (+12.00%), the social insurance budget about 18.00 billion lei (+9.70%), and local budgets and the mandatory health insurance funds approximately 6.10 billion lei each.
Energy and Resources
On August 5, between 6:00 p.m. and 9:00 p.m., the projected commercial electricity shortfall totaled 303 MWh: 62 MWh, 129 MWh and 112 MWh by hour. The Ministry of Energy and Energocom said they were ready to use emergency supply mechanisms; the regional shortfall was linked to the heat, higher consumption and generation constraints caused by low water levels in the Danube.
Government Regulation
The government approved a draft law on the recognition and operation of producer organizations in the agri-food sector, including joint processing, storage, procurement and marketing. At the same time, provisions establishing a separate Horticulture Bureau will be removed from the Horticulture Law, avoiding duplication of functions and new financial obligations for producers and exporters.
The Competition Council fined Labromed Laborator 683.10 thousand lei for excessive prices for breathalyzers, mouthpieces and calibration. The markup on breathalyzers reached 490%, on mouthpieces 733%, and the gross margin on calibration 1,039%; for three years, the company must disclose prices and costs to the regulator annually.
The government will allocate up to 75.00 thousand euros for a technical expert in the Park Avenue Capital arbitration against Moldova over management rights to the .md domain. It previously budgeted 129.60 thousand euros for legal support and an advance of $150.00 thousand to the International Centre for Settlement of Investment Disputes.
Investment and Projects
The authorized capital of the state-owned enterprise Moldova Railways will be increased by 421.10 million lei to rehabilitate infrastructure and continue the modernization of the Bender-Basarabeasca-Etulia-Giurgiulești section, financed with the participation of the EBRD and EIB.
A tender has been announced to repair about 8.10 km of the R26 road in Causeni District; the contract is valued at 17.49 million lei excluding VAT, to be financed from the Road Fund. Bids are due by August 21.
The government approved the first stage of the defense program through 2030, costing 10.59 billion lei: about 40% is planned to be financed from the state budget, nearly 35% from foreign aid, while about 25% currently lacks funding sources.
Agriculture
Agricultural producer prices fell by 4.60% year on year in H1: crop product prices decreased by 8.50%, while livestock product prices rose by 1.60%. Open-field vegetables fell in price by 29.40%, fruits and berries by 23.50%, while eggs rose by 25.60%.
In July, AIPA approved subsidies totaling 56.01 million lei, versus 53.96 million lei in June. Of this, 45.68 million lei was allocated through LEADER to 507 projects, including 265 business initiatives; as of July 1, 928.59 million lei remained in the agricultural fund.
Social Economy
Mandatory health insurance fund revenues for January-July exceeded 9.00 billion lei, rising by 693.00 million lei (+8.30%); spending exceeded 10.70 billion lei. About 1.30 billion lei more was transferred for medical services, medicines and medical devices than a year earlier.
